Water, Water Everywhere Water is one of the most important staples for health and fitness. If we are dehydrated, it can trigger a host of physical problems—from fatigue and headaches to muscle cramps and poor recovery—sometimes leading to bewildering health expenses when the solution is simple: DRINK MORE WATER!. Foam rolling is widely used to “loosen” muscles and relieve tension—but evidence now shows it may actually damage your fascia, the tissue connecting every part of your body. The Science: How Foam Rolling Impacts Fascia Fascia is a sensitive, dynamic system that absorbs shock, communicates feedback, maintains posture, and coordinates movement. When starting a health journey, the lure of the latest fad diet is everywhere. “Lose 10 pounds in two weeks!” “Detox, cleanse, transform!”—but as science and long-term results show, fad diets are rarely sustainable and can leave big holes in your nutrition and health.
